package azuremachineconditions
import (
"context"
creatingcondition "github.com/giantswarm/conditions-handler/pkg/conditions/creating"
upgradingcondition "github.com/giantswarm/conditions-handler/pkg/conditions/upgrading"
"github.com/giantswarm/microerror"
"github.com/giantswarm/micrologger"
corev1 "k8s.io/api/core/v1"
capz "sigs.k8s.io/cluster-api-provider-azure/api/v1beta1"
capi "sigs.k8s.io/cluster-api/api/v1beta1"
capiconditions "sigs.k8s.io/cluster-api/util/conditions"
"sigs.k8s.io/controller-runtime/pkg/client"
azureclient "github.com/giantswarm/azure-operator/v6/client"
"github.com/giantswarm/azure-operator/v6/pkg/azureconditions"
)
const (
// Name is the identifier of the resource.
Name = "azuremachineconditions"
)
type Config struct {
AzureClientsFactory *azureclient.OrganizationFactory
CtrlClient client.Client
Logger micrologger.Logger
}
// Resource ensures that AzureMachinePool Status Conditions are set.
type Resource struct {
azureClientsFactory *azureclient.OrganizationFactory
ctrlClient client.Client
logger micrologger.Logger
creatingConditionHandler *creatingcondition.Handler
deploymentChecker *azureconditions.DeploymentChecker
upgradingConditionHandler *upgradingcondition.Handler
}
func New(config Config) (*Resource, error) {
if config.AzureClientsFactory == nil {
return nil, microerror.Maskf(invalidConfigError, "%T.AzureClientsFactory must not be empty", config)
}
if config.CtrlClient == nil {
return nil, microerror.Maskf(invalidConfigError, "%T.CtrlClient must not be empty", config)
}
if config.Logger == nil {
return nil, microerror.Maskf(invalidConfigError, "%T.Logger must not be empty", config)
}
c := azureconditions.DeploymentCheckerConfig{
CtrlClient: config.CtrlClient,
Logger: config.Logger,
}
dc, err := azureconditions.NewDeploymentChecker(c)
if err != nil {
return nil, microerror.Mask(err)
}
var creatingConditionHandler *creatingcondition.Handler
{
c := creatingcondition.HandlerConfig{
CtrlClient: config.CtrlClient,
Logger: config.Logger,
Name: "azureMachineCreatingHandler",
UpdateStatus: false, // azuremachineconditions handler will do the update
}
creatingConditionHandler, err = creatingcondition.NewHandler(c)
if err != nil {
return nil, microerror.Mask(err)
}
}
var upgradingConditionHandler *upgradingcondition.Handler
{
c := upgradingcondition.HandlerConfig{
CtrlClient: config.CtrlClient,
Logger: config.Logger,
Name: "azureMachineUpgradingHandler",
UpdateStatus: false, // azuremachineconditions handler will do the update
}
upgradingConditionHandler, err = upgradingcondition.NewHandler(c)
if err != nil {
return nil, microerror.Mask(err)
}
}
r := &Resource{
azureClientsFactory: config.AzureClientsFactory,
ctrlClient: config.CtrlClient,
logger: config.Logger,
deploymentChecker: dc,
creatingConditionHandler: creatingConditionHandler,
upgradingConditionHandler: upgradingConditionHandler,
}
return r, nil
}
// Name returns the resource name.
func (r *Resource) Name() string {
return Name
}
func (r *Resource) logConditionStatus(ctx context.Context, azureMachine *capz.AzureMachine, conditionType capi.ConditionType) {
condition := capiconditions.Get(azureMachine, conditionType)
if condition == nil {
r.logger.Debugf(ctx, "condition %s not set", conditionType)
} else {
messageFormat := "condition %s set to %s"
messageArgs := []interface{}{conditionType, condition.Status}
if condition.Status != corev1.ConditionTrue {
messageFormat += ", Reason=%s, Severity=%s, Message=%s"
messageArgs = append(messageArgs, condition.Reason)
messageArgs = append(messageArgs, condition.Severity)
messageArgs = append(messageArgs, condition.Message)
}
r.logger.Debugf(ctx, messageFormat, messageArgs...)
}
}
